Big Pharma's Influence on Medical Education: A $3 Million Question
Stanford University received a $3 million grant from Pfizer in 2010 to develop unbiased postgraduate courses for doctors. However, the video raises concerns about potential industry influence on medical education. News reports from that era show a pattern of pharmaceutical companies funding medical education programs, sometimes leading to concerns about bias. One expert interviewed in the video states, "If you accept a $3 million dollar grant from Pfizer, do we really think that's not going to have an influence on what students are going to learn?" The issue remains relevant today, highlighting the ongoing need for transparency and ethical considerations in medical education funding.
